ToolsNotion is where you organize projects, take notes, and manage knowledge. Your Reddit saves — the career advice, coding tutorials, research threads, and reference material you bookmarked — should live there too. But Reddit has no export, and Notion has no Reddit integration.
Readdit Later bridges the gap. Export your entire save library to a Notion database with one click, or set up daily, weekly, or monthly auto-export so new saves flow into Notion automatically. Each post becomes a database entry with subreddit, title, URL, score, post type, your labels, and your notes intact.
